機械翻訳について

コレクションの読取り

get

/content/management/api/v1.1/repositories/{id}/collections/{collectionId}

コレクションを読み取ります。

リクエスト

パス・パラメータ
問合せパラメータ
トップに戻る

レスポンス

サポートされているメディア・タイプ

200レスポンス

OK。
本文()
ルート・スキーマ: Collection
型: object
コレクション
ソースを表示
ネストされたスキーマ : channels
型: array
コレクションに関連付けられているチャネル。
ソースを表示
ネストされたスキーマ : date
型: object
date
ソースを表示
ネストされたスキーマ : RepositoryIdentifier
型: object
RepositoryIdentifier
ソースを表示
ネストされたスキーマ : ruleGroups
型: array
ソースを表示
ネストされたスキーマ : ChannelInCollections
型: object
ChannelInCollections
ソースを表示
ネストされたスキーマ : RuleGroup
型: object
ルール・グループ定義
ソースを表示
  • ルール・グループに関連付けられたアセット・タイプ。ルール・グループ内のすべてのルールは、このアセット・タイプに関連するプロパティに基づきます
    例: File
  • このルール・グループを前のグループと結合するときに使用する演算子
    例: OR
  • ruleSet
    ルール・グループに関連付けられたルールのセット
ネストされたスキーマ : ruleSet
型: array
ルール・グループに関連付けられたルールのセット
ソースを表示
ネストされたスキーマ : RuleSet
型: object
ルールまたは条件のセット
ソースを表示
ネストされたスキーマ: Rule
型: object
ソースを表示
ネストされたスキーマ : ruleSet
型: array
指定されたルール・セットに関連付けられた子またはサブ・ルール・セット
ソースを表示

304 レスポンス

変更されていません。

400レスポンス

不正リクエスト

403レスポンス

禁止。

404レスポンス

見つかりません。

500レスポンス

内部サーバー・エラー
トップに戻る

次の例は、cURLを使用してGETリクエストを発行することで、コレクションの詳細とそのIDを取得する方法を示しています。

curl -X GET -H 'Accept: application/json' 'https://host:port/content/management/api/v1.1/repositories/{id}/collections/{collectionId}'

例:

これはIdでコレクションを読み取ります: O9F1CD681C619D182B27A9FA3154E81BEEA1E8587407、idのリポジトリに存在: F264EF72737B35991E381047D5B43D87656640771B3C

/content/management/api/v1.1/repositories/F264EF72737B35991E381047D5B43D87656640771B3C/collections/O9F1CD681C619D182B27A9FA3154E81BEEA1E8587407

レスポンス本文

{
    "id": "O9F1CD681C619D182B27A9FA3154E81BEEA1E8587407",
    "repository": {
    "id": "F264EF72737B35991E381047D5B43D87656640771B3C",
    "name": "Repo12395550356833265"
    },
    "name": "Collection2",
    "description": "",
    "createdBy": "marketing.user",
    "createdDate": {
    "value": "2018-12-10T07:01:57.062Z",
    "timezone": "UTC"
    },
    "updatedBy": "marketing.user",
    "updatedDate": {
    "value": "2018-12-10T07:54:02.198Z",
    "timezone": "UTC"
    },
    "channels": [
    {
      "id": "CC03EC1531E0E39F6D6BA75CEE430DDBEA79EDD5F5B0",
      "name": "channel2"
    },
    {
      "id": "CCB59F44D5015819EBC0F86A2B3133B22638AF433F1E",
      "name": "channel1"
    }
    ],
    "links": [
    {
      "href": "https://host:port/content/management/api/v1.1/repositories/F264EF72737B35991E381047D5B43D87656640771B3C/collections/O9F1CD681C619D182B27A9FA3154E81BEEA1E8587407",
      "rel": "self",
      "method": "GET",
      "mediaType": "application/json"
    },
    {
      "href": "https://host:port/content/management/api/v1.1/repositories/F264EF72737B35991E381047D5B43D87656640771B3C/collections/O9F1CD681C619D182B27A9FA3154E81BEEA1E8587407",
      "rel": "canonical",
      "method": "GET",
      "mediaType": "application/json"
    },
    {
      "href": "https://host:port/content/management/api/v1.1/metadata-catalog/repositories/F264EF72737B35991E381047D5B43D87656640771B3C/collections/O9F1CD681C619D182B27A9FA3154E81BEEA1E8587407",
      "rel": "describedby",
      "method": "GET",
      "mediaType": "application/schema+json"
    }
    ]
    }
先頭に戻る